Overview
Trifluoroacetic anhydride (CAS 407-25-0 ), commonly abbreviated as TFAA, is a highly reactive acylating agent used across pharmaceutical synthesis, specialty polymer production, and chemical manufacturing.
It activates and protects functional groups in complex organic molecules, enabling reactions that would otherwise require harsher or less selective conditions for the manufacturer.
In pharmaceutical and agrochemical synthesis, TFAA introduces trifluoroacetyl groups to amines, alcohols, and other nucleophiles, supporting the production of APIs and intermediates.
Polymer and specialty materials manufacturers use it to modify surface properties and introduce fluorine content into polymer backbones, improving thermal stability and flame retardant performance.
In textile and leather processing, TFAA-based treatments contribute to surface modification and preservation chemistry, extending material durability and enhancing the quality of the finished goods.
Printing and packaging applications leverage its reactivity in the preparation of specialty coatings and functional additives where controlled acylation is required for high-performance results.
TFAA is supplied as a colorless liquid, typically in high-purity grades suited to pharmaceutical and fine chemical synthesis. Standard commercial offerings include reagent-grade and technical-grade specifications.
Purity levels are commonly at 99% or higher for synthesis-critical applications. Packaging ranges from small laboratory quantities to bulk drums for industrial procurement and large-scale operations.

Physical Properties
| Melting Point | -65 °C |
| Boiling Point | 40 °C |
| Density | 1.511 g/cm³ (liquid) |
| Flash Point | -26 °C |
| Appearance | Clear, colorless liquid |
| Color | Clear |
| Form | Liquid |
| Water Solubility | Hydrolysis |
| Vapor Pressure | 6.28 psi ( 20 °C) |
| Refractive Index | n 20/D 1.3(lit.) |
| Log P | 0.79 at 25℃ |
